Where to Use Rose Mini Quilt-C with Care

While Rose Mini Quilt-C is incredibly versatile, there are a few embroidery considerations to keep in mind. Due to its detailed elements and possible small lettering, it’s best suited for medium to large hoop sizes. Attempting it on a small hoop might compromise the clarity of the design.

Also, keep in mind that repeated washing—especially for kitchen towels or aprons—can affect the longevity of the embroidery if not stitched with durability in mind.

Designer Tips for Best Results

Before launching this design into your seasonal collection, here are a few practical steps to ensure professional results:

  1. Check hoop size compatibility with your machine and intended product.
  2. Test thread colors on sample fabric to match seasonal palettes.
  3. Use a quality stabilizer to maintain stitch integrity on textured or stretchy fabrics.
  4. Review the stitch density—especially for layered elements or small text.
  5. Create realistic mockups to visualize how the design looks on different items.
  6. Confirm commercial licensing details before selling finished products.

Also, take time to examine the design after stitching—small details can get lost or distorted depending on fabric texture and tension. Always plan for a test run before mass production.
